Winnipeg is a small market with expensive clicks. That combination catches people off guard.
The search volume here is a fraction of Toronto's, so there's a hard ceiling on how much traffic any keyword can send you. But the businesses competing for those searches are often well-established, well-funded, and have been bidding on the same terms for years. In competitive verticals like personal injury law, insurance, and emergency home services, a single click in Winnipeg can cost more than most people expect for a market this size.

The core of most Winnipeg campaigns. We build tightly themed campaigns around commercial-intent keywords, write ad copy that actually matches what the searcher typed, and manage bids against lead cost rather than click cost.
For eligible trades and home service businesses, LSA puts you above the standard ads with a Google Screened badge, and you pay per lead instead of per click. Eligibility and available categories vary, so we'll confirm whether your business qualifies before recommending it.
For retailers and e-commerce. PMax is powerful and opaque in equal measure, so we run it with a clean product feed, asset groups built by margin rather than category, and enough exclusions that it doesn't quietly spend your entire budget on brand searches you'd have won for free.
Most people don't convert on the first visit. We build audience segments based on real behaviour (visited the pricing page, started a form, abandoned a cart) instead of blasting the same banner at everyone who ever loaded your homepage.
Frequently ignored, and that's exactly why it's worth running. The audience skews older and higher-income, the competition is thinner, and clicks generally cost less than the equivalent Google terms. For B2B and professional services in particular, it's often the cheapest qualified traffic in the account.
Better for demand generation than demand capture. Useful when you're selling something people don't know to search for yet, or when you're retargeting people who already know you.
Expensive per click, occasionally worth every cent. If you sell to a specific job title at a specific company size, nothing else targets that precisely.

Here's a scenario that plays out constantly.
An agency audits your account and finds the real problem isn't the ads. It's that your contact form is buried below the fold, your site takes six seconds to load on mobile, your phone calls aren't tracked, and closed deals never make it back into Google Ads so the algorithm is optimizing toward whichever leads happen to fill out forms rather than whichever leads actually buy.
The agency writes this up in a recommendations deck and sends it to your web developer. Then everyone waits.

Traffic starts the day campaigns go live. Useful leads usually follow within the first week or two. Reliable performance takes 60 to 90 days, because bidding algorithms need conversion volume before they get good, and early data is noisy.
PPC buys visibility immediately and stops the moment you stop paying. SEO builds visibility slowly and keeps working after the invoice clears. Most Winnipeg businesses run both: paid for immediate lead flow and for testing which keywords actually convert, organic for the long-term cost per lead. Data from your ad campaigns is genuinely useful for pointing your SEO strategy at terms you've already proven make money.

Depends entirely on what a customer is worth to you. A $200 cost per lead is a disaster for a business with $400 jobs and a bargain for one closing $40,000 contracts. We set targets against your actual close rate and deal value, not industry averages.
